GUIDE HACHETTE 2023
Château Martet is one of 18 Bordeaux 1st and 2nd Grands Crus Classés to receive the ultimate award: both Coup de Coeur and 3 stars !
"A pure Merlot aged 18 months in new barrels and presented in numbered bottles. The wine lives up to all its promises, built around intense black fruit, between blackcurrant and blackberry, but also hints of violet and raspberry. The palate is powerful and dense, underlined by well-melted tannins and plenty of freshness. Clearly a wine for laying down, tannic but not overly so, with a long, lingering finish."

June 2022 - Vigneron Magazine
"Blend yes, lock yourself in no. On these hillsides, we're free from dogma, but not from the highest standards. The wine, a living substance, has the structure, style and roundness of Martet's blends.
On the hillsides bordering the Dordogne, we are offered a Bordeaux of another time, of another color. Particularly in the heart of the Sainte-Foy-Côtes deBordeaux appellation and its landscape of hills separated by valleys where rivers and streams shape the entire vineyard. Arriving in Eynesse, Château Martet's stronghold, the Papillondominates the horizon, but it's the old 13th-century building that really catches the eye. This former hospice of the Templar Order has belonged to the Coninck family since 1991, as have the surrounding 50 hectares of vines and woods.

Nina Mitjavile took over from her brother Louis (Mitjavile) in 2021: "In love with the wines of Pomerol, the Coninck family decided to produce a 100% Merlot(s) cuvée on these more or less sandy-clay terroirs punctuated with gravel. Some will say that it's easier to make wines from a single grape variety, but I say that it's a slippery slope. If you make a mistake, there's nothing to readjust! The name says it all: Réserve de Famille. "As for the Cabernet Franc parcels, they have a role to play (15%) in the blend of the second wine, Les Hauts de Martet. We don't rectify the blend, as we want the climatic conditions inherent to each vintage to be the only imponderable!"
